Amazon’s Influencer Program is Going All Out for Prime Day: July 12-13 is Amazon Prime Day 🎉 Amazon is using its Influencer Program to endorse products & spread awareness for Prime Day. Amazon's been investing in its Influencer Program by creating tools & content development opportunities. Modern Retail reports that Amazon held a few events, like a trip to Mexico, so creators could make content ahead of time for Prime Day. Amazon will also let influencers create shoppable videos, “share Prime Day picks to their followers via commissional links,” and more. While influencers have mixed feelings on Amazon, a big lure is the “commission halo effect” - creators earn for 24 hrs from “the time a customer clicks through their link to Amazon and makes any qualifying purchases across the site.” Read the full article here.

Stranger Things 👑 of Product Placement:  Don’t worry if you haven’t seen this season of Stranger Things, there’s no spoilers ahead...except all the product placements. Coke, Lacoste, Jif Peanut Butter, and Reebok were all featured in Season 4 and prove that hit TV shows like Stranger Things are a “valuable vehicle for product placement.” According to this blog, 140 brands have been spotted in Stranger Things since Season 3. Marketing Dive reports that Coke’s placement value is $1.83M and Lacoste's $1.8M despite being featured in just one episode. Netflix subscribers should expect to see more brands on the platform. The streaming service confirmed it will be offering an ad-supported tier by the end of 2022.

No Live Shopping for The US Says TikTok: It looks like “TikTok Shop” (TikTok’s live shopping platform) is no longer coming to the US reports the Financial Times. TikTok tested the waters for Shop by launching it in the UK last year, but it failed to gain traction. Despite live shopping failing to catch on in the west, Asian countries have embraced live shopping for several years. TikTok’s parent company ByteDance, which is popular in China, has a very strong live shopping program. Read more here.

Episode #65: Conner Sherline

Back in December 2020, we spoke to Conner Sherline, the co-founder & CEO of Disco (FKA Co-op Commerce). A lot has happened in two years! Here's a brief overview of some highlights what Sherline & his team are up to now.

  • First, let's address the obvious. Co-op Commerce changed its name to Disco in March 2022.

  • Along with the name change, Disco made another announcement. It raised $20M Series A led by Felicis Ventures. Other participant included Shopify, Sugar Capital, Not Boring Fund, and more!
